Many mortgage providers require a mortgagee clause in place to grant a mortgage. A mortgagee clause states that if a property is damaged during the mortgage period, the insurance company must pay the mortgagee for this.
A defeasance clause is a term within a mortgage contract that states the propertys title will be transferred to the borrower (mortgagor) when they satisfy payment conditions from the lender (mortgagee).
One of the most important clauses in a loan agreement is the operative loan clause. This details when and how money is to be advanced by the lender to the borrower; the amount of money being advanced; and what (if any) conditions have to be satisfied prior to money being advanced.
A power of sale is a clause, sometimes permitted by local law to be inserted into mortgages or deeds of trust, that grants the creditor or trustee the right to sell the property upon certain defaults without court authority.
A due on sale clause which specifies that the mortgagee can accelerate the debt if the property is sold without the mortgagees permissions is a typical clause in a mortgage document.
The alienation clause in a mortgage contract gives a mortgage lender the right to request the full and immediate repayment of the loan, including principal and interest, when the borrower sells or transfers their home.
